Commit graph

1534 commits

Author SHA1 Message Date
jenkins-bot 4156e030c8 Merge "Remove (X) next to Alerts/Messages if there is one section" 2014-09-09 23:28:35 +00:00
jdlrobson 2cacf82efa Restore QUnit tests to reflect alert as default tab
This reverts the tests and amends them after the
application of commit 5da9eac08a.

Luckily nothing appears to be broken.

Change-Id: I67acfe5dc74ef750d5443dd619dbb114623ee233
2014-09-09 13:23:37 -07:00
bsitu 75d5c9b9a3 Remove (X) next to Alerts/Messages if there is one section
Change-Id: Ibf66328e31bfefb3d588196c3f4babfa65bb52f3
Eg: Alerts(X) becomes Alerts
2014-09-09 11:12:38 -07:00
Matthias Mullie b090b749de Messages/Alerts text is tiny in Monobook
Just like all other text elements in the overlay: set the font-size to 13px
Not sure why this was em & rest px. 13px is equivalent to the current 0.8em in
Vector.

Change-Id: I29d67f21cc2af7209469299ab228ebe7dac98af7
2014-09-09 18:01:36 +02:00
bsitu 9c55aa0fc8 Colors are backwards for flyout section link
Also make active section link not clickable

Change-Id: I7f391929382489e8bad5ab56fea9f2ef7b2978b0
2014-09-09 16:31:23 +02:00
jenkins-bot 4aa508b6a8 Merge "Default to alerts tab" 2014-09-08 21:42:29 +00:00
jenkins-bot 91d102131e Merge "Mark notifications as read if they fail rendering" 2014-09-08 21:27:26 +00:00
Erik Bernhardson 97417af20c Mark notifications as read if they fail rendering
The only issue is that the badge is not up to date till
you refresh the page, I think that's fine for now

Change-Id: I585b4cc185bf859ddb06829df75309ff3d56d8b8
2014-09-08 14:22:10 -07:00
jenkins-bot f39ad2d842 Merge "mw.echo.overlay.updateCount() no longer exists" 2014-09-08 20:44:09 +00:00
Erik Bernhardson 5da9eac08a Default to alerts tab
The only exception is when there are new message notifications but no new
alert notifications.

Bug: 70461
Change-Id: I06daa3f7d526beeb878eb343c169e01acd49e71f
2014-09-08 13:18:51 -07:00
jenkins-bot 66cdad22c8 Merge "Hygiene: Give ApiStub modes names instead of numbers" 2014-09-08 19:11:36 +00:00
jenkins-bot ad0bf2dadd Merge "Hygiene: Dont run jshint against .less files" 2014-09-08 10:40:37 +00:00
Translation updater bot b89163bbfd Localisation updates from https://translatewiki.net.
Change-Id: I681e050ecb04cc85dae46b0715edf096e9a72615
2014-09-07 21:59:02 +02:00
Erik Bernhardson 584394fcde Hygiene: Give ApiStub modes names instead of numbers
Change-Id: Ia01ba14a1b2ab179454f14e5a1595ff468c46fc5
2014-09-05 16:52:42 -07:00
Erik Bernhardson c88261148d Hygiene: Dont run jshint against .less files
Change-Id: Ib90f706160b5404fa278e09e5a79bb83e8911500
2014-09-05 16:45:34 -07:00
bsitu d9f697414f mw.echo.overlay.updateCount() no longer exists
If you have an unread notifications not in the initial
load of special page, clicking load more would throw
an error

Bug: 69714
Change-Id: I9af588780b2ab8481ba252ddc21bad0601de7a0b
2014-09-05 21:37:12 +00:00
Translation updater bot f8a8caa93b Localisation updates from https://translatewiki.net.
Change-Id: If0a6fa28d14803765880f0de57407fc517062ed1
2014-09-05 22:45:14 +02:00
jenkins-bot f89a4a5a71 Merge "Allow .mw-echo-title-heading outside special page" 2014-09-05 10:06:13 +00:00
Erik Bernhardson f5985169cc Allow .mw-echo-title-heading outside special page
This class was only being applied to notification output
on special pages and not in the overlay, move it so it can.

Additionally:
* bolds .mw-echo-title-heading same as the anchors it works with
* clean up a repeated rule against `.mw-echo-title a`

Change-Id: I579252399b39746f5aa2cfc51b5cd3b9b8b2cdb0
2014-09-04 18:59:30 -07:00
Translation updater bot 0df890a326 Localisation updates from https://translatewiki.net.
Change-Id: I2e7369aac77031b1b28abceca88af3c53fba2155
2014-09-04 22:06:44 +02:00
jenkins-bot f6b46c6c44 Merge "QA: make Feature names easy to read" 2014-09-03 21:46:58 +00:00
Translation updater bot 06391e909c Localisation updates from https://translatewiki.net.
Change-Id: I0affcb73660a9dd7ddbaa1699a8baf73c4228370
2014-09-03 22:19:00 +02:00
Translation updater bot 81ea248737 Localisation updates from https://translatewiki.net.
Change-Id: Ic29e92fc314d3a23685e4451270a3cfc9d03fe3c
2014-09-02 22:12:51 +02:00
Cmcmahon 76665c552a QA: make Feature names easy to read
Don't duplicate "Notification types" Feature between tests. I
guess this was a copy/paste issue.

Change-Id: I032130024113bb326f0cfbbe09cd7455bdaf7ab5
2014-09-02 10:26:59 -07:00
jenkins-bot f09f11d679 Merge "There is no welcome notification" 2014-09-02 07:34:24 +00:00
jenkins-bot d662e57d7e Merge "Set UnitTestsList hook run against files inside tests/phpunit" 2014-09-01 22:10:03 +00:00
Translation updater bot da1e4dc0eb Localisation updates from https://translatewiki.net.
Change-Id: I9c40775534fda35d87c050420b5d3bc791bb8a90
2014-08-31 21:54:24 +02:00
Translation updater bot a74e085414 Localisation updates from https://translatewiki.net.
Change-Id: Ibedff15da1e664297c40d7d84339620a8b15170f
2014-08-30 22:36:45 +02:00
bsitu 2d38a4c8a8 There is no welcome notification
Bug: 70139
Change-Id: Ice565a23073dac0c39d61801cad34c9c9419b2dc
2014-08-28 14:29:45 -07:00
jdlrobson d8702e46b4 QA: Add browser test for user rights change
Change-Id: I9cb453d1107d0fe961abb32d358a4c00bb9f40c8
2014-08-28 13:57:03 -07:00
Translation updater bot 255a365980 Localisation updates from https://translatewiki.net.
Change-Id: I998f7fd7ce828be7854a99fcc853f44503772fb3
2014-08-28 22:28:36 +02:00
jenkins-bot 11a7422671 Merge "Add profiling to Echo notification API" 2014-08-28 17:01:16 +00:00
Nemo bis 940ea72ab5 Remove trailing whitespace, followup 0b1275b9e3
Change-Id: I1d48f9c3c0af68496bf0672c76202bf00063cb34
2014-08-28 12:06:06 +03:00
bsitu 669080b376 Add profiling to Echo notification API
Change-Id: I427622aa67037e33eabab02c0adf13a2abf59377
2014-08-27 17:26:58 -07:00
jenkins-bot e39c521750 Merge "Fallback to master lookup for title when lookup in slave fails" 2014-08-27 22:52:35 +00:00
jenkins-bot 15a6ad6591 Merge "Specify which event type to use job queue" 2014-08-27 21:08:25 +00:00
Translation updater bot 7f1bc64b08 Localisation updates from https://translatewiki.net.
Change-Id: I8a66fe58b9ca3c9648f47f4a7dd457818f2d133a
2014-08-27 21:23:38 +02:00
bsitu 65bb14b33e Specify which event type to use job queue
This will allow us to specify which notifications to use job queue

Change-Id: I7bf576acf332f5344b35188b5262df2319d15b79
2014-08-27 11:39:53 -07:00
Cmcmahon c982b0a4fa QA: update to fix deprecated API token call
Change-Id: I8046af1add07e26e40fc000a9feeab65b75e4b68
2014-08-27 08:57:45 -07:00
bsitu cb971c4ca0 Fallback to master lookup for title when lookup in slave fails
Bug: 69913
Change-Id: I5d6a4ec750dc8438c92c9e70c36554ff7dbc97f1
2014-08-26 22:33:28 +00:00
bsitu 17828f7953 Continue offset is missing in the read API
When the notification is retrieved without unread first,
it should have a continue offset for next batch of loading

Change-Id: I101990faaf9ed3e3786805aff3906b846d62f612
2014-08-26 13:12:22 -07:00
Translation updater bot f9701b360f Localisation updates from https://translatewiki.net.
Change-Id: I9a2b2ad53ac74bd8b964b57c4d25f12d02a043ce
2014-08-26 21:47:56 +02:00
Reedy 7859b148ce Fix Call to protected method EchoNotificationController::isWhitelistedByUser()
Change-Id: I1f53172d70785c1d4def400b785442e7512ec92c
2014-08-26 19:58:34 +01:00
jenkins-bot d807d9f62e Merge "Hygiene: Move notification type detection to method" 2014-08-25 22:06:17 +00:00
jenkins-bot e8fbe64853 Merge "Hygiene: Move master/slave code to MWEchoDbFactory" 2014-08-25 21:50:02 +00:00
Translation updater bot 15d75c4cdb Localisation updates from https://translatewiki.net.
Change-Id: Ie90d4c91f61c667d76bf992d5f09aa4aee792a30
2014-08-23 21:53:16 +02:00
bsitu db218b9e1f Set UnitTestsList hook run against files inside tests/phpunit
All php unit tests are inside this directory

Change-Id: Ib5ac7c31bf08e68dbc5f66b9fb06e150569e7104
2014-08-22 17:39:00 -07:00
bsitu f29f7303d1 Make timestamp in consistent format after loaded from database
Notification timestamp is generated in MW format (YYYYMMDDHHMMSS)
inside the model and saved to the database in db specific format,
We need to convert it back to MW format when loading the data
from the database, it just happens that MW format is the same
as MySQL timestamp format

Change-Id: Ie881b66c8c24d57a8933c0153e9e7db5fe6aa017
2014-08-22 15:53:51 -07:00
jenkins-bot 979b3e6425 Merge "Revert "Make timestamp in consistent format after loaded from database"" 2014-08-22 21:52:02 +00:00
Bsitu 271d192f69 Revert "Make timestamp in consistent format after loaded from database"
It should handle NULL

This reverts commit 31a986bebd.

Change-Id: I202a7c6f8deaf0b6bbf3af1981f4f25077e916db
2014-08-22 21:50:34 +00:00